Overview
The Rogue Rotating V-Grip Cable Attachment is a precision-engineered accessory designed to enhance upper body isolation exercises including tricep pushdowns, cable curls, lat pulldowns, and low rows. Built with Rogue's signature durability, it features 32MM anodized aluminum H-5 handles and a full 360-degree swivel mechanism. This rotating design allows for free wrist movement, reducing joint strain and ensuring a smooth, natural range of motion throughout every repetition.

Key Features and Specifications
Swivel Mechanism: 360-degree rotating swivel equipped with bronze bushings for fluid, unrestricted movement.
Handle Design: Uses Rogue 32MM H-5 anodized aluminum handles (5” length) with knurled grips and flanged rests for secure hand placement.
Heavy-Duty Construction: 3/8” thick stainless steel clevis plate combined with 1/4” and 5/16” thick steel side plates.
Customization: Standard 90-degree center hub with an optional 70-degree conversion kit available for alternative hand positioning.
Finish: Textured black powder-coated steel frame with multiple anodized handle color options (Black, Red, Blue, etc.).
Weight: 3.5 lbs.
Dimensions: 14.4" W x 5.8" H.
Manufacturing: Proudly Made in the USA.
Performance Benefits
Reduced Joint Strain: The 360-degree rotation allows the handles to follow the natural path of the wrists and elbows, significantly reducing the "twisting" discomfort often felt with fixed V-bars.
Precision Control: High-quality knurling (similar to Rogue’s Ohio Bar) provides a secure, non-slip grip, allowing the athlete to focus entirely on muscle contraction.
Fluid Transitions: Bronze bushings ensure that the rotation remains smooth even under heavy loads, preventing the "jerky" movement common in budget cable attachments.
Versatility: Equally effective for both pushing (triceps) and pulling (curls/rows) movements due to the balanced center of rotation.
Compact Portability: Lightweight and small enough to fit in a standard gym bag, making it a perfect personal attachment for use in commercial gyms.
Maintenance and Care
Bushing Maintenance: The bronze bushings are designed for longevity, but a single drop of light machine oil (like 3-in-1 oil) applied to the swivel joint once or twice a year will ensure maximum smoothness.
Cleaning: Wipe the anodized handles with a damp cloth and mild soap to remove chalk and hand oils. Use a plastic bristle brush to clear the knurling if it becomes clogged.
Finish Protection: Avoid metal-on-metal contact between the aluminum handles and the cable machine's carabiner or rack to prevent scratching the anodized finish.
Inspection: Regularly check the clevis plate and side plate bolts for tightness.
Storage: Store in a dry environment. The stainless steel and powder-coated components are rust-resistant, but keeping them dry will maintain the finish for years.
Warranty Information
The Rogue Rotating V-Grip Cable Attachment is backed by Rogue’s Limited Lifetime Warranty. This covers defects in materials, structural functionality, and workmanship for the original purchaser. The warranty does not cover aesthetic damage to the powder coat or anodized finish resulting from normal wear and tear.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Is the rotation too loose? : The rotation is designed to be exceptionally smooth to accommodate various movement patterns. While it may feel "fast" at first, this prevents the weight from forcing your wrists into uncomfortable angles.
Q: Can I change the angle of the handles? : The standard unit is fixed at 90 degrees. However, Rogue offers an optional 70 Degree Kit that can be purchased separately to change the angle for a different ergonomic feel.
Q: Does it come with a carabiner? : No, the attachment is sold as a standalone unit. It is compatible with most standard gym carabiners.
Q: Will this fit in a standard gym bag? : Yes. At just under 15 inches wide and weighing 3.5 lbs, it is very portable.
